In the early evening, la merienda , a light snack of coffee and rolls or sandwiches, is served. This meal is often very informal and may be just for children. Merienda is a light meal in southern Europe, particularly Spain (merenda in Galician, berenar in Catalan), Portugal (lanche or merenda) and Italy (merenda), as well as Hispanic America, The Philippines (meryenda/merienda), North Africa (Morocco), and Brazil (lanche or merenda).
